PokerStars Women’s Winter Festival Coming to London This November

PokerStars Women’s Winter Festival Coming to London This November – The first-ever Women’s Winter Festival will include a ladies-only Main Event with a £100,000 guarantee, as well as a number of other exciting events focused around female… PokerStars has been spearheading efforts to encourage more women to play poker for some time, and these efforts will culminate in the Women’s Winter Festival , which will take place in London starting November 21.

Headlined by a £100,000 guaranteed Main Event , the Festival will feature several female-only events, along with an exciting 50/50 tournament and a handful of off-the-felt activities for all the players who make the trip to London in November.

First introduced at an exclusive Ladies Day Breakfast meet & greet, the Women’s Winter Festival was made into a reality by PokerStars Ambassador Kerryjane Craige , who will be taking charge of organizing the event and promoting it with the ladies over the next couple of months.

Craige commented on the upcoming Festival, saying: “I am so excited about this event, honing in on the schedule and finalising the details truly gave me goosebumps. Opportunities for women to have access to more inspirational poker events is a driver to all that I do.”

“The Women’s Only Main Event is to enable and encourage women to participate in live poker games with aspirational outcomes. The attention to every detail of this four-day festival has been amazing to be part of and I believe we have hit the mark. We have built an event around the audience – now I am hoping they will come.” Exciting Schedule with Unique Ladies Events

The inaugural PokerStars Women’s Winter Festival will run over a 4 day period and include four unique poker events, all focused around female participation.

The focal point of the entire Festival will be the £400 buyin Women’s Only Main Event with a £100,000 guaranteed prize pool, the biggest ladies’ event ever played in the UK.
